1How quickly should I respond to water damage in my Cedar Grove home, and are there seasonal concerns I should know about?

Immediate response is critical, ideally within 24-48 hours, to prevent mold growth and structural damage. In Cedar Grove, our humid summers can accelerate mold, while winter freezes can cause pipes to burst; prompt action is key year-round. Always prioritize safety by shutting off electricity to the affected area before contacting a local restoration professional.

2What should I look for when choosing a fire and smoke damage restoration company in Franklin County?

Verify the company is licensed and insured in Indiana and holds certifications from the IICRC (Institute of Inspection Cleaning and Restoration Certification). Choose a provider with 24/7 emergency services, as fires don't wait, and one familiar with local building codes in Cedar Grove and Franklin County to ensure repairs meet all regulations.

3Are restoration costs in the Cedar Grove area typically covered by homeowners insurance?

Most standard homeowners insurance policies in Indiana cover sudden and accidental damage from events like burst pipes, storms, or fires. However, coverage for gradual damage (like slow leaks) or flooding typically requires separate riders. Always document the damage with photos, file a claim promptly, and work with a restoration company that can provide detailed estimates for your insurer.

5After a basement flood in Cedar Grove, what are the specific steps a local restoration company will take?

A professional team will first extract all standing water using industrial-grade pumps and vacuums. They will then set up specialized air movers and dehumidifiers, calibrated for our regional humidity, to dry structural materials thoroughly. Finally, they will sanitize the area and monitor moisture levels to Indiana standards to ensure your basement is truly dry and safe, preventing future mold issues.
